防範SQL注入攻擊

【原文地址】Tip/Trick: Guard Against SQL Injection Attacks【原文發表日期】 Saturday, September 30, 2006 9:11 AM SQL注入攻擊是非常令人討厭的安全性漏洞,是所有的web開發人員,不管是什麼平台,技術,還是資料層,需要確信他們理解和防止的東西。不幸的是,開發人員往往不集中花點時間在這上面,以至他們的應用,更糟糕的是,他們的客戶極其容易受到攻擊。 Michael Sutton

XMMS中文顯示

可能是我比較懷舊,或者是自己老了,跟不上時代了,試了幾個MP3播放器總用不習慣,展轉反覆又換回老朋友XMMS。不過XMMS有個問題就是中文顯示設定比較麻煩(其實主要還是自己不太會玩兒),每次都被搞的暈頭轉向。後來發現一個規則就是先設定好/etc/gtk/gtkrc.zh_CN,然後使XMMS的字型設定和/etc/gtk/gtkrc.zh_CN的一樣就可以解決問題。我的/etc/gtk/gtkrc.zh_CN的設定為Code highlighting produced by Actipro

WebService(筆記)

通過SOAP在web上提供的軟體服務(基於XML協議)使用WSDL檔案進行說明(基於XML語言,描述webservice及其函數/參數/傳回值)通過UDDI進行註冊(通用發現/說明和整合,相當於web服務的黃頁,包含一組使企業將自身提供的web service註冊時的別的企業能夠發現的訪問協議) 中介軟體平台的缺陷:無法擴充到互連網上,它們要求服務的用戶端與系統提供的服務本身之間必須進行緊密耦合,即要求一個同類基本結構 Web

Repository模式(zhuan)

近來發現很多ASP.NET MVC的例子中都使用了Repository模式,比如Oxite,ScottGu最近發布的免費的ASP.NET MVC教程都使用了該模式。就簡單看了下。 在《企業架構模式》中,譯者將Repository翻譯為資產庫。給出如下說明:通過用來訪問領域對象的一個類似集合的介面,在領域與資料對應層之間進行協調。 在《領域驅動設計:軟體核心複雜性應對之道》中,譯者將Repository翻譯為倉儲,給出如下說明:一種用來封裝儲存,讀取和尋找行為的機制,它類比了一個對象集合。

應用程式定義域和程式集

本主題描述應用程式定義域和程式集之間的關係。您必須首先將一個程式集載入到應用程式定義域中,然後才能運行該應用程式。運行普通的應用程式會導致將幾個程式集載入到一個應用程式定義域中。預設情況下,公用語言運行庫將一個程式集載入到包含引用該程式集的代碼的應用程式定義域。通過此方法,該程式集的代碼和資料獨立於使用該程式集的應用程式。       如果程式集由一個進程中的多個域使用,則該程式集的代碼(而非資料)可以由引用該程式集的所有域來共用。這將降低運行時所使用的記憶體量。這種共用組件代碼的方法類似於  

.net事務機制

事務的ACID屬性:原則性(Atomicity)一致性(Consistency)隔離性(Isolation)持久性(Durability).net開發人員可以使用一下午中事務機制:SQL和預存程序層級的事務     優勢:所有事務邏輯包含在一個單獨調用中;擁有運行一個事務的最佳效能;獨立於應用程式     限制:事務上下文僅存在於資料庫調用中;資料庫代碼與資料庫系統有關ADO.NET層級的事務    

LFS從硬碟啟動進行安裝的嘗試–失敗!

為了省下一張光碟片,我想讓LFS從硬碟啟動進行安裝,這裡的從硬碟啟動我希望啟動的是LFS光碟片裡的系統,因為用LFS光碟片環境安裝成功的幾率比較大。這裡對實現過程做個記錄。1.未成功的方法:我開始認為只要把光碟片中的內容解出來,然後設定系統啟動時運行光碟片的核心就可以了,所以我先在虛擬機器中配置好DOS環境,把LFS光碟片解壓到硬碟中,再由loadlin.exe調入LFS核心,結果啟動過程出現如下錯誤:Code highlighting produced by Actipro

擴充IE WebControls之一:讓Toolbar支援用戶端事件

    作者:donna donna.zdn@gmail.com 自由轉載 但請保留作者資訊    關於IE

X61 Xfce下設定音量控制

這裡有一篇文章介紹X61在Slackware下KDE環境中的音量控制問題,我用Xfce,其實差不多,我寫了個更簡單的指令碼:CodeCode highlighting produced by Actipro CodeHighlighter (freeware)http://www.CodeHighlighter.com/-->#!/bin/bashcase "$1" in    mute)        amixer -c 0 sset Headphone off        amixer -

{定義介紹}什麼是REST 收藏

 REST架構風格是全新的針對Web應用的開發風格,是當今世界最成功的互連網超媒體分布式系統架構,它使得人們真正理解了Http協議本來面貌。隨著 REST架構成為主流技術,一種全新的互連網網路應用開發的思維方式開始流行。 REST是什麼      REST是英文Representational State Transfer的縮寫,中文翻譯為“具象狀態傳輸”,他是由Roy Thomas Fielding博士在他的論文 《Architectural Styles and the Design

擴充IE WebControls之二:讓TreeView的每個節點顯示自己的ToolTip

作者:donna donna.zdn@gmail.com 自由轉載 但請保留作者資訊        我在自己的網頁中用TreeView來做菜單導航,實際使用中經常遇到這種情況:由於需要顯示的內容比較長而頁面上又沒有充足的空間來顯示,導至使用者不能看到節點的全部內容。於是我想到了ToolTip屬性,當使用者用滑鼠指向某一節點時,在ToolTip裡顯示該項的使用內容。但TreeView控制項並沒有提供節點的ToolTip屬性,於是就有了這篇隨筆。       

GDI+ 中的基數樣條,基數樣條曲線的Demo

文章目錄 物理和數學樣條 [MSDN]GDI+

23個.NET開源項目(zhuan)

Eric Nelson是微軟技術的傳道者,也是MSDN UK Flash的技術編輯,他編寫了一個列表,列出23個UK開發人員推薦的.NET開源項目。微軟的一些開源項目如ASP.NET MVC、DLR、IronRuby、IronPython、MEF等則未列入其中。Eric嘗試只包含一個測試架構和一個mock架構,即使有很多其它的項目同樣入圍。他列出了以下項目: [TEST] xUnit.net - 用於TDD的最好的測試架構之一。 [TEST] RhinoMocks mocking

什麼叫應用程式定義域?(zhuan)

 一:應用程式定義域 介紹:     "域",就是範圍,環境,邊界的意思,那麼什麼是應用程式定義域,官方給出的是這樣的解釋:作業系統和運行庫環境通常會在應用程式間提供某種形式的隔離.     應用程式定義域為安全性、可靠性、版本控制以及卸載程式集提供了隔離邊界。應用程式定義域通常由運行庫宿主建立,運行庫宿主負責在運行應用程式之前引導公用語言運行庫。 

優酷網(Youku.com)架構經驗(zhuan)

這次 QCon (北京)會議網站架構案例分析這個 Track ,雖然話題不多,但課程設計時候考慮覆蓋的面還是比較廣的。作為視頻網站代表,優酷帶來了一場包含不少實戰經驗的技術分享。邱丹(優酷網開發副總裁,核心架構師)可能公司的事情比較忙,一直到第二天中午才趕到會場。還半開玩笑說,'怎麼這麼多人,還以為是小型的會議呢'...緩衝緩衝黃金原則:讓資料更靠近 CPU。CPU-->CPU 一級緩衝-->二級緩衝-->記憶體-->硬碟-->LAN-->WAN講到了

程式集(zhuan)

文章目錄     作為一個單元進資料列版本設定和部署的一個或多個檔案的集合。程式集是 .NET Framework 應用程式的主要構造塊。所有託管類型和資源都包含在某個程式集內,並被標記為只能在該程式集的內部訪問,或者被標記為可以從其他程式集中的代碼訪問。程式集在安全方面也起著重要作用。代碼訪問安全系統使用程式集資訊來確定為程式集中的代碼授與權限集。 程式集是 .NET Framework 編程的基本組成部分。程式集執行以下功能:

Facebook 如何管理150億張照片(zhuan)

Facebook 的照片分享很受歡迎,迄今,Facebook 使用者已經上傳了150億張照片,加上縮圖,總容量超過1.5PB,而每周新增的照片為2億2000萬張,約25TB,高峰期,Facebook 每秒處理55萬張照片,這些數字讓如何管理這些資料成為一個巨大的挑戰。本文由 Facebook 工程師撰寫,講述了他們是如何管理這些照片的。舊的 NFS 照片架構老的照片系統架構分以下幾個層:上傳層接收使用者上傳的照片並儲存在 NFS 儲存層。 照片服務層接收 HTTP 要求並從 NFS

Slackware 12.1-Xfce 4.4.2下安裝電池監視器外掛程式編譯出錯的解決方案

http://goodies.xfce.org/提供了許多Xfce環境下的外掛程式,其中有個電池監視器外掛程式,按照安裝說明中的步驟編譯時間出現如下錯誤:Code highlighting produced by Actipro CodeHighlighter

MmMapIoSpace和MmUnMapIoSpace

應用程式訪問物理地址之MmMapIoSpace 應用環境:WinCE500 在應用程式中使用的都是虛擬位址,如果要對物理地址進行操作 需要用到MmMapIoSpace把物理地址映射到虛擬位址如: 如:pBaseAddress = (PUCHAR)MmMapIoSpace(ioPhysicalBase, Size, FALSE); 同上,訪問pBaseAddress的指向地址,就為訪問被映射後ioPhysicalBase定義的物理地址。 PVOID

初次使用GRUB2

剛裝了Slackware12.1,用GRUB2啟動。本來以為GRUB2是GRUB的最新版,一用才知道我錯了。GRUB2源自PUPA,代碼已經被重新編寫,實現模組化並且增強了可移植性,除了名字以外好像和GRUB沒什麼關係,可以認為GRUB2是一個全新的boot loader。GRUB2的目標是實現:實現指令碼支援,如條件判斷、迴圈、變數和函數提供圖形化介面提供模組動態載入功能,可以在運行時實現功能擴充增強可移植性國際化支援記憶體管理跨平台安裝解決救援模式無法啟動問題,去掉了Stage

總頁數: 61357 1 .... 12448 12449 12450 12451 12452 .... 61357 Go to: 前往

聯繫我們

該頁面正文內容均來源於網絡整理,並不代表阿里雲官方的觀點,該頁面所提到的產品和服務也與阿里云無關,如果該頁面內容對您造成了困擾,歡迎寫郵件給我們,收到郵件我們將在5個工作日內處理。

如果您發現本社區中有涉嫌抄襲的內容,歡迎發送郵件至: info-contact@alibabacloud.com 進行舉報並提供相關證據,工作人員會在 5 個工作天內聯絡您,一經查實,本站將立刻刪除涉嫌侵權內容。

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.